“Training”
Years of training made the process instinctual. Slap. The magazine was firmly in place. It was always in place but he still checked every time. Pull. The charging handle slid smoothly. The first thing you learned was how to care for your weapon. Observe. The chamber was empty – no obstructions visible. Release. He let go of the charging handle. One case of bolt bite – long ago – and he had never ridden the handle again. Tap. The bolt was fully forward and locked. Shoot. Training made it instinct… even when the targets were no longer paper people. He squeezed the trigger. |
